Developer’s DescriptionCollaborative content management for distributed teams.Content Circles revolutionizes the way people collaborate and publish content of any sort - graphics, CAD drawings, videos, images, contracts, financial reports, presentations, and more. If you store it on your computer or company network and share it with other people, then Content Circles can help you do it better, faster and more securely, right from your desktop, without having to buy or learn any new desktop or enterprise software! Content Circles uses the model of "Circles of Interest," similar to social networking applications, but with the assurance that only your trusted group can ever access the shared content. Your content will never be stored online by us and can never be accessed by anyone without your permission. Content is automatically updated and replicated between Circle members so everyone has access to the latest information, even when they're offline. * Unlike e-mail, Content Circles provides structure for managing your content including version management and access control, eliminates all file size limitations, provides automatic backup for all your files, and is 100% spam-free. You never have to burn large files on to CDs/DVDs and ship them around to get your job done. * Unlike enterprise content repositories, Content Circles makes access to relevant content to all team members, including those outside the firewall, in a controlled and auditable way. You don't need to open up your firewall or provide VPN access to everyone just so they can access some content. * Unlike web-based content repositories, Content Circles does not require you to put your content, including confidential financial and legal documents, out on the world-wide-web just so your team members outside the firewall can access that content to get their job done.

Design by KisaDesign.To nail it down in one word: curves. Visual artists have known for millennia that curves make an image more fun because the eye “dances” to follow the lines. Fun logos almost always use curves, circles and rounded edges and stay away from blocky and square shapes (which are more the domain of formal industries like banking).All the logos above have prominent curves, whether full on circles like Denton or the less ostentatious half-moon shapes for JobMatch Talent.Curves are inherently playful, and you can apply them in varying degrees. The most fun logos have curves everywhere, such as Joylla using both a cloud shape and a cursive typography. However, even more serious brands can temper their formal side by adding a few curves, such as Storage Squirrel centering their logo around a dominant S shape.Silly shapes work best for brands that…want to soften their image, either a little or a lot. If a brand wants to be excessively playful, they can add overlapping curves, spirals and circles to their heart’s content. But even more serious brands can seem just a tad friendlier by enclosing their logo in a simple circle.Whimsical wordmarks—Logo design by badem for Tail Spin Slots.If you don’t want to go full throttle Seussian, playful typography is a moderate path for making a serious brand just a little more approachable.Cursive writing, as in the logo for Birth, Etc., is always a safe choice for fun logos. Again, curves come into play, as cursive writing is inherently more playful than blocky fonts. However, cursive can sometimes come across as ritzy or dainty, so it’s not for every brand.You can choose a retro typography like Stella Times, but be sure to choose the best time period for your brand. Another creative option is to add artistic flourishes to your words, like the horns on the W in the Wicked Cilantro logo or the fox tail for Tail Spin Slots.When all else fails, you can invent your own font, which can also be a strategic choice in communicating what your brand does. In Photoshop,’ these three reasons will offer more clarity.#1. You Can Scale Images Without Quality LossOne of the most significant advantages of smart objects comes with scaling. When you’ve cut out an image or created a shape, the last thing you want is to lose quality as you scale. Smart objects give you the most flexibility with this.Let me show you exactly how this works.Here I’ve created two circles. The red circle is a regular layer, while the blue circle is a smart object.I’ll grab my move tool and rescale both circles to a tiny size.At this point, both circles still look the same, just smaller. Now let’s scale them back up again.Now the difference between the regular layer and the smart object is glaring. The red circle has become pixelated while the blue circle still looks sharp. This is the power of a smart object at work.Since the smart object puts the blue circle in a ‘container,’ you never resize the actual shape. You’re just scaling the container. This means that no matter how many times you adjust this container, the contents will look the same.With a regular layer, you’re directly editing the source content. In this case, the source content is the red circle. When you scale the circle down, it has to fit itself into a smaller number of pixels. Once you scale up this small circle, there isn’t enough information left to maintain a sharp edge like before. That’s why you end up with fuzzy edges.#2.Blog Archive - The Content Circle
